Output f66abd0fbf45bd639aaff2a4e8a9d1d54bab485490566228d4e3c60789cf40fe:1

value
886630621
script pubkey
OP_0 OP_PUSHBYTES_20 ea8db3e2674cc856313fc4ba17a14c9030475f24
address
ltc1qa2xm8cn8fny9vvflcjap0g2vjqcywheys8ffl8
transaction
f66abd0fbf45bd639aaff2a4e8a9d1d54bab485490566228d4e3c60789cf40fe
spent
true